Meeting notes — Vexlight GPU tooling sync. We went back and forth on whether the profiler should sample allocations per-kernel or per-stream; consensus landed on per-stream with an opt-in kernel drilldown, since the overhead of the kernel hooks was killing the Tornbeck benchmarks. Also agreed the memory timeline export should drop the custom binary format and just emit the trace schema the Quillport viewer already reads. Sign-off on the final tooling spec goes to:

approver of bagug-bagag = Holael Pramir

## Service Accounts — StormFan Alert Fan-Out

The fan-out worker authenticates to the internal dispatch tier using the svc-stormfan account. Rotate quarterly; scopes are limited to publish-only on alert topics. If deliveries stall during your shift, verify the worker is using the current credential, reproduced below for reference.

API key for kaweg-hahif: kto4_rAjZ

**Goods Lift — Visitor Policy.** The east goods lift at Merrow Court is for deliveries only. Do not route visitors or contractors through it. Couriers must be escorted by facilities staff at all times. The lift car is key-switched after 18:00. For daytime operation, enter the lift control code shown below.

turnstile pass: bdg-FVNQRS-72965873

## Seat-map renderer: restart procedure

Applies to the Velvet Curtain renderer for the Marlowe Hall venue. If tiles render blank, drain the render queue, clear the layout cache, restart one pod at a time. Verify hall geometry loads before re-enabling bookings. Do not restart during an active on-sale. Confirm the pod comes back with the renderer configuration values shown below.

settings of fafog-haduf:
ZORIX_PIN=4648
ZORIX_METRICS_HOST=metrics.zorix.paliqsys.corp
ZORIX_LOG_LEVEL=info
ZORIX_TENANT=druix